Android入门课件:3G技术详解与智能手机平台概览
需积分: 0 150 浏览量
更新于2024-08-01
收藏 1018KB PPT 举报
本篇Android初学者课件由高级软件人才实作培训专家黎活明讲师制作,主要针对3G应用开发进行讲解。首先,介绍了3G的基本概念,它是一种第三代数字通信技术,包括WCDMA、CDMA2000和TD-SCDMA等不同制式,其中WCDMA被全球广泛采用。3G相较于1G和2G的主要优势在于其能够支持多媒体服务,如高速数据传输和多种信息服务。
随着3G的推出,2.5G技术作为过渡阶段的产品,如CDMA20001X和GPRS,它们在2G向3G的演进过程中起到了桥梁作用,引入了WAP和蓝牙技术,丰富了移动通信功能。
课件还重点讲解了智能手机软件平台,列举了多个主流平台,如Symbian、Windows Mobile、RIM BlackBerry、Android、iPhone、Palm以及Brew和Java/J2ME。在2009年的市场份额中,Symbian占据主导地位,其次是RIM BlackBerry和iPhone,而Android尽管起步较晚,但凭借其开源特性和发展势头,获得了1.8%的份额,显示出强劲的增长潜力。
Android部分,它是由Google在2007年发布,基于Linux平台的开放源代码手机操作系统。这个平台由操作系统核心、中间件和服务层构成,为开发者提供了丰富的API,使得手机可以实现各种功能,如应用程序开发、多媒体处理和互联网接入等。随着Android的不断发展,它已成为全球最受欢迎的移动操作系统之一,对移动设备市场产生了深远影响。通过学习这个课件,初学者可以了解Android的基础架构,掌握开发入门技能,并为未来在这个平台上进行深入工作做好准备。
2018-04-04 上传
2019-08-03 上传
2012-08-14 上传
2009-10-14 上传
2014-09-19 上传
2018-06-19 上传
2018-06-01 上传
2012-12-15 上传
ksallandou0423
- 粉丝: 0
- 资源: 14
最新资源
- 单片机串口通信仿真与代码实现详解
- LVGL GUI-Guider工具:设计并仿真LVGL界面
- Unity3D魔幻风格游戏UI界面与按钮图标素材详解
- MFC VC++实现串口温度数据显示源代码分析
- JEE培训项目:jee-todolist深度解析
- 74LS138译码器在单片机应用中的实现方法
- Android平台的动物象棋游戏应用开发
- C++系统测试项目:毕业设计与课程实践指南
- WZYAVPlayer:一个适用于iOS的视频播放控件
- ASP实现校园学生信息在线管理系统设计与实践
- 使用node-webkit和AngularJS打造跨平台桌面应用
- C#实现递归绘制圆形的探索
- C++语言项目开发:烟花效果动画实现
- 高效子网掩码计算器:网络工具中的必备应用
- 用Django构建个人博客网站的学习之旅
- SpringBoot微服务搭建与Spring Cloud实践